/*-------------------------------------------------------------------------
|
|
|
|
*
|
|
|
|
* syscache.h
|
|
|
|
* System catalog cache definitions.
|
|
|
|
*
|
|
|
|
* See also lsyscache.h, which provides convenience routines for
|
|
|
|
* common cache-lookup operations.
|
|
|
|
*
|
|
|
|
* Portions Copyright (c) 1996-2001, PostgreSQL Global Development Group
|
|
|
|
* Portions Copyright (c) 1994, Regents of the University of California
|
|
|
|
*
|
|
|
|
* $Id: syscache.h,v 1.28 2001/01/24 19:43:29 momjian Exp $
|
|
|
|
*
|
|
|
|
*-------------------------------------------------------------------------
|
|
|
|
*/
|
|
|
|
#ifndef SYSCACHE_H
|
|
|
|
#define SYSCACHE_H
|
|
|
|
|
|
|
|
#include "access/htup.h"
|
|
|
|
|
|
|
|
/*
|
|
|
|
* Declarations for util/syscache.c.
|
|
|
|
*
|
|
|
|
* SysCache identifiers.
|
|
|
|
*
|
|
|
|
* The order of these must match the order
|
|
|
|
* they are entered into the structure cacheinfo[] in syscache.c.
|
|
|
|
* Keep them in alphabetical order.
|
|
|
|
*/
|
|
|
|
|
|
|
|
#define AGGNAME 0
|
|
|
|
#define AMNAME 1
|
|
|
|
#define AMOPOPID 2
|
|
|
|
#define AMOPSTRATEGY 3
|
|
|
|
#define ATTNAME 4
|
|
|
|
#define ATTNUM 5
|
|
|
|
#define CLADEFTYPE 6
|
|
|
|
#define CLANAME 7
|
|
|
|
#define GRONAME 8
|
|
|
|
#define GROSYSID 9
|
|
|
|
#define INDEXRELID 10
|
|
|
|
#define INHRELID 11
|
|
|
|
#define LANGNAME 12
|
|
|
|
#define LANGOID 13
|
|
|
|
#define LISTENREL 14
|
|
|
|
#define OPERNAME 15
|
|
|
|
#define OPEROID 16
|
|
|
|
#define PROCNAME 17
|
|
|
|
#define PROCOID 18
|
|
|
|
#define RELNAME 19
|
|
|
|
#define RELOID 20
|
|
|
|
#define RULENAME 21
|
|
|
|
#define RULEOID 22
|
|
|
|
#define SHADOWNAME 23
|
|
|
|
#define SHADOWSYSID 24
|
|
|
|
#define STATRELID 25
|
|
|
|
#define TYPENAME 26
|
|
|
|
#define TYPEOID 27
|
|
|
|
|
|
|
|
extern void InitCatalogCache(void);
|
|
|
|
|
|
|
|
extern HeapTuple SearchSysCache(int cacheId,
|
|
|
|
Datum key1, Datum key2, Datum key3, Datum key4);
|
|
|
|
extern void ReleaseSysCache(HeapTuple tuple);
|
|
|
|
|
|
|
|
/* convenience routines */
|
|
|
|
extern HeapTuple SearchSysCacheCopy(int cacheId,
|
|
|
|
Datum key1, Datum key2, Datum key3, Datum key4);
|
|
|
|
extern Oid GetSysCacheOid(int cacheId,
|
|
|
|
Datum key1, Datum key2, Datum key3, Datum key4);
|
|
|
|
|
|
|
|
/* macro for just probing for existence of a tuple via the syscache */
|
|
|
|
#define SearchSysCacheExists(c,k1,k2,k3,k4) \
|
|
|
|
OidIsValid(GetSysCacheOid(c,k1,k2,k3,k4))
|
|
|
|
|
|
|
|
extern Datum SysCacheGetAttr(int cacheId, HeapTuple tup,
|
|
|
|
AttrNumber attributeNumber, bool *isNull);
|
|
|
|
|
|
|
|
#endif /* SYSCACHE_H */
